PRESSURE SUSTAINING VALVE VALSTEAM

admin

The ADCA PS45 series pressure sustaining valves are single seat bellows sealed controllers, operating without auxiliary energy, designed for use on steam, compressed air, industrial inert gases and liquids compatible with the construction.
They are particularly suitable for sustaining steam pressure in all energy and process systems where upstream pressures should be kept constant.

PILOT OPERATED PRESSURE REDUCING VALVES (Steel/St. Steel)

admin

The ADCA PRV47 pilot operated pressure reducing valves are designed for use on steam, compressed air, nitrogen and other gases compatible with the construction and they can be installed on pressure reducing stations throughout all industries.
Connections are flanged or threaded.

Forged Steel Body

admin

The ADCA PRV25/2S series direct acting pressure
reducing valves are designed for use on steam,
compressed air and other gases.
They are suitable for reducing steam pressure at the
point of use on laundry machines, dyeing, food
industries, sterilizers, etc.
Connections are female screwed or flanged.

MAIN FEATURES

Compact design.
Bellows specially designed for high durability.
Built-in strainer.

OPTIONS:

Regulating screw with top cap.
USE: Saturated steam, compressed air and other
gases compatible with the construction.

AVAILABLE MODELS:

PRV25/2S – metal to metal seating

PRV25/2SG – soft valve

PRW25/2S – soft valve balanced

RECOMMENDED APPLICATIONS :

PRV25/2S – steam and compressed air

PRV25/2SG – steam and compresswhere tight off is required
PRW25/2S – water, compressed air

WATER SAVING JET-SPRAY GUN ADCAMIX

admin

The SG20 water-saving gun is specially recommended to be used along with the Adcamix MX20 steam to water mixers. By using this gun, water and energy costs can be considerably reduced and it also contributes to the environment protection avoiding the use of chemicals in the cleaning process. The valve is opened and closed by operating the lever which regulates the flow from a mist to a concentrated jet.
The lock catch facilitates the continuous operation. The valve is designed for industrial use, it is extremely robust. It is protected against shock, heat and cold by caustic and acid-resistant rubber cladding.

FLASH VESSELS (With inbuilt steam trap)

admin

The flash vessel is the main component in any flash
recovery system. It can be used in all steam plants where high pressure condensate is reduced to a lower pressure, so that flash steam is formed by re-evaporation. This steam can be used in low pressure process or heating equipments. Connections are flanged or screwed on request.
